The future of data modelling is here, powered by Artificial Intelligence

An intelligent data modeling tool with real-time collaboration, version control, built for modern development teams.

Why Data Modeler Pro?

🤖

AI-Powered Modeling

Use natural language to generate complex data models in seconds. Our AI understands your requirements and builds schemas intelligently.

👥

Real-Time Collaboration

Work with your team on the same data model simultaneously. See changes live and resolve conflicts with ease.

📚

Version Control & History

Track every change with GitHub-powered versioning. Compare versions side-by-side with visual diffs, and maintain complete project history with detailed change tracking.

💻

Code Generation

Automatically generate SQL, TypeScript types, and API routes from your data models. Accelerate your development workflow.

🛡️

Enterprise-Ready Security

Implement robust security from day one with built-in RLS policies, authentication, and compliance features.

🏢

Multi-Tenant Architecture

Support for multiple tenants with data isolation and role-based access control, perfect for SaaS applications.

🗃️

PostgreSQL Schema Import

Connect directly to your PostgreSQL database and import existing schemas instantly. View table structures, relationships, and data counts in real-time.

🌊

Animated Data Flow Visualization

Understand how data flows throughout your model with interactive animations. Hover over relationships to see animated data flow paths.

Modern Tech Stack

Built with Next.js for performance and Supabase for reliable data storage. Enjoy a fast, scalable platform with enterprise-grade infrastructure.

Collaborate in Real-Time

Build and refine your data models with your entire team. Our real-time collaboration features, inspired by tools like Figma, allow multiple users to work on the same diagram simultaneously. See cursors move, changes appear instantly, and stay in sync without conflicts.

  • ✓ Live cursors and presence indicators
  • ✓ Instant updates across all connected clients
  • ✓ Role-based access control for secure collaboration
Real-time collaboration in Data Modeler Pro

Empowering Business Teams & Data Analysts

Data Modeler Pro bridges the gap between business requirements and technical implementation. Design complex data models using natural language, reverse engineer existing databases, and collaborate seamlessly without needing SQL or DBML expertise.

  • ✓ Natural language to data model conversion with AI assistance.
  • ✓ Reverse engineer PostgreSQL schemas and identify bottlenecks.
  • ✓ Multiple views: conceptual, logical, and physical models.
  • ✓ Perfect for consulting firms and data analysis teams.
DataModeler Pro Interface